Heroic Shattered Halls
#1
We tried to get a Heroic Shattered Hall group together yesterday evening to increase our pool of Nightbane summoners (to three:P) but had trouble finding a fifth. The eventual group consisted of me as warrior tank, mage, hunter and two raid-healing specced Paladins.

Since I had never gotten around to doing the Trials of the Naaru quest in here, I thought this would be a good opportunity but was also worried that the lack of dps would thwart any attempt at making it in time.

Well, it was a cakewalk. Nobody in our group had ever been in Heroic SH but there aren't that many differences to a normal run. While three members were quite overgeared for it, me among them, it was still almost boring, not the thrill I imagined it would be. When I ran normal SH I was Fury spec and in mostly tier 2 tank gear and found it to be quite a challenge, never before did I have to tank as many mobs simultaneously. In short, I found it a fun in that it kept me on my toes and really trying to do my best. Apart from holding aggro against the Gladiator's Crossbow of the hunter, there were hardly any of those emotions in my recent Heroic run.

Now, I realise that all Heroics got hit with the nerfstick pretty hard recently, I hadn't anticipated it would be that bad when I read reports of fellow lurkers that had done them pre-nerf. I was under the impression that SH would be one of the more challenging Heroic instances, something of a 5-man raid experience. Meh:(

Any suggestions on where to turn for challenging 5-man content? I did enjoy the sense of real teamwork when we started, the feeling that "this is going to be hard, we really all need to do our best and work together well" that manisfested itself in Paladins stunning mobs I lost after less than a second, which made re-acquiring them trivial and the very nice coordination of our two crowd controllers. But the realisation that "it ain't really necessary" kind of took away a bit of that.

One observation I also made was that while trash groups are mostly boring (more so in Heroic Shadow Labyrinth that I ran a couple of days earlier), the bosses turned into annoying timesinks. At least they were hard, to a degree, but mostly they seem to enjoy vastly improved health pools that just serve to prolongue the fights.

Is there even any 5-man content that is challenging for raid-level gear?
